CRAAP TEST Currency Relevance Authority Accuracy Purpose

Comic Evaluation What argument or idea is the cartoon presenting? What evidence can you give that support your identification of this argument/idea? What arguments or ideas does the cartoon ignore? Who is the intended audience for the cartoon?
